White Rose 2021 Press kit

JAIDO Studios in connection with Two Fish Five Loaves Entertainment presents "White Rose". A short film that brings awareness to child sex trafficking in the United States. White Rose has been recognized internationally, winning Best USA Short Film and the Viewer's Choice Award at the Toronto International Nollywood Film Festival; as well as, Best Director at Europe Film Festival. We are finalists in New Cinema - Lisbon Festival (Portugal), New Wave Short Film Festival (Germany) and Roma Short Film Festival (Italy). The film is nominated for Best Film at the Liberian Entertainment Awards and Best Movie at LEA Australia. Domestically, we've been awarded Semi-Finalist at New York Cinematography AWARDS (NYCA) and selected for the New York Tri-State International Film Festival.

Synopsis

What would you do if you found out that the people who promised to protect you were the very ones on assignment to derail you from your destiny? White Rose takes you front row and center into the life of Mia Robinson. A very resilient pre-teen African-American girl who faces the biggest obstacle of her entire life before she even enters high school. Life as she knows it comes to a screeching halt as she is forced to fight for her very survival.
